Job Description
Your future role at a glance:
Location:
Brookfield, WI Facility:
Elmbrook Memorial Hospital Department/Speciality:
Surgery Schedule:
Days l Full-time How you'll make an impact in this role: Providing direct assistance to surgeons throughout surgical procedures. Positioning patients to ensure optimal exposure for the procedure using stabilizing equipment while prioritizing patient comfort and safety. Ensuring clear visualization of the operative site through tissue manipulation, retraction, sponging, suctioning, and irrigation. Utilizing appropriate techniques to achieve both temporary and permanent hemostasis. Assisting with body plane closure, the application of wound dressings, and the securing of drainage systems. What minimum qualifications you'll need:Licensure/Certification/Registration:
BLS Provider obtained within 1 Month (30 days) of hire date or job transfer date required. American Heart Association or American Red Cross accepted. Surgical Assistant credentialed from the National Board of Surgical Technology and Surgical Assisting (NBSTSA) preferred.Education:
High School diploma equivalency with 2 years of cumulative experience OR Associate's degree/Technical degree OR 4 years of applicable cumulative job specific experience required. What additional requirements you'll need: Experience in Orthopedics, Davinci Robotics, Urology, Neuro and General Surgery preferred. At least 4 years as an ST in lieu of accredited first assistant program. Life atAscension:
